Where to find the CGC certification number and QR code

Every CGC slab carries a certification number on its label, beside the CGC QR code. Enter that number to confirm the card's description and grade in provider sources. The QR code and the printed number point to the same record, so scanning is just a faster way to reach it, not a separate proof that the holder is genuine.

Fraud Alert checks for CGC certification numbers

A genuine CGC certification number, label image or QR can be copied onto a counterfeit holder. That is why a matching record is one part of a purchase check, not a final authenticity verdict. CheckCOA screens every CGC cert lookup against a growing database of more than 25,000 reported fake, stolen, reused and compromised certificate numbers to help you avoid already-reported risks before you buy.

A clean result is not a guarantee of authenticity. A real number can still be reused on a fake slab, so compare the label layout, the card details inside the holder and any provider image before buying.

What does no results mean on a CGC card lookup?

Typos, the wrong CGC category selected, an unsupported lookup type, or limited source availability. Recheck the digits and confirm the item is a CGC graded card.

How do I avoid counterfeit CGC slabs?

Verify the number and compare high-resolution label photos. A matching certification number confirms a record exists; a real number can still be copied onto a counterfeit holder, so compare the label layout, card details and any provider image.
